Filter monitor

The type PMP differential pressure sensors are designed for monitoring filters for air and other gases. The compact microprocessor controlled units are housed in a robust plastic casing with an enclosure class of IP65.

Two hose connections allow easy connection to the process before and after the filter. The measuring range runs from 0 to 50 mbar. The measuring process that is used registers even tiny pressure differences with great accuracy. Meanwhile, the sensor is safe against overloads up to 750 mbar.

One 4-20 mA analog output and two relay outputs are available and the easy-to-operate electronics offer all necessary settings. The relays, their time delay, the hysteresis as well as the analog signal are freely programmable. A 4-digit LED display provides direct information on the spot.

With the aid of the type PMP differential pressure sensors, the cleaning or replacement of filters can be carried out dependent on the degree of contamination and precisely at the right time. Energy losses due to clogged or used filters can be easily and inexpensively avoided.
